Henkel has launched a novel medical-grade light-cure adhesive designed for devices that are to be worn on the body. The new product is formulated without IBOA (isobornyl acrylate) or any other known skin sensitizing monomers. The adhesive is also formulated to conform to EU MDR 2017 regulations concerning use of CMR (carcinogenic, mutagenic, or toxic for reproduction) substances in medical devices, making it a robust option for new designs.
The newly developed adhesive is available in two different grades. Loctite WT 3001 and Loctite WT 3003 have both been tested according to ISO 10993 standards, ensuring a high level of safety and performance for users.
